Mass redistribution in variable mass systems

Abstract

We have developed an alternative formulation based on F=Ma{\bf F} = M {\bf a} rather than F=dP/dt{\bf F} = d{\bf P}/dt for studying variable mass systems. It is shown that F=Ma{\bf F} = M {\bf a} can be particularly useful in this context, as illustrated by various examples involving chains and ropes. The method implies the division of the whole system into two parts, which are considered separately, allowing to explore certain aspects as constraint forces.
